Solution for What is 610 increased by 200 percent? (610 plus 200%):

610 + (200/100 * 610) = 1830

Now we have: 610 increased by 200 percent = 1830

Question: What is 610 increased by 200 percent?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We have a with value of 610.

Step 2: We have b with value of 200.

Step 3: The formula for calculation will be: a + (b/100 * a) = x.

Step 4: We could also represent this as: x = a + (\frac{b}{100} * a).

Step 5: We now replace with the values: x = 610 + (\frac{200}{100} * 610).

Step 6: That gives us an {x} = {1830}

Therefore, {610} increased by {200\%} is {1830}
